Output ec6f0f264d8c7b57046ce1c5bc962ecf8208e6f357b0310633547f09c6922a2a:1

value
722176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dcaa1edcb686fc6a6d9f02fa4bf5e589a79dae OP_EQUAL
address
34KdBxNp3vM92M4pvcgXv84gXPSFgzXVdz
transaction
ec6f0f264d8c7b57046ce1c5bc962ecf8208e6f357b0310633547f09c6922a2a
confirmations
185163
spent
true